After he was arrested for a physical altercation with his brother, Frank, on Tuesday in New Jersey, Mike “The Situation” Sorrentino left the Middletown Township police station with a brand-new look. To go with his buff body, the former Jersey Shore star sported a gray tank top, sweats – and a black eye. His right hand was also bandaged. Sorrentino was booked on charges of simple assault and posted $500 bail after he and Frank reportedly got into a fight at the Boca Tanning Salon. The brothers have started up the hot spot as a main storyline in Sorrentino’s upcoming reality show, The Sorrentinos, which follows the family business and the 31-year-old’s road to recovery after his 2012 rehab stint.
